Output 3688d5b68fc5a008e88ef1f71622cfa5fffa429fa5b6bdd491f633c326f145df:1

value
320030071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66aac35eccf6b50ae6779a65c5cd6a5932a0b06c OP_EQUAL
address
3B3sQwf8Vp4fY3azEABCakLmd27b5bHQWF
transaction
3688d5b68fc5a008e88ef1f71622cfa5fffa429fa5b6bdd491f633c326f145df
spent
true